Students Flying in Microgravity
Brief Description: Undergraduate college science students in varying fields of science will demonstrate the effects of microgravity on ordinary items, present an open forum to all age levels . Topics will include how to do science for the space program and how microgravity effects the human body. Plant seeds that have actually flown in space will be brought to the classroom for the students to grow. Students will also be shown a video.
